Unraveling The Spatial Distribution Of The Acidity Of Hzsm-5 Zeolite On The Level Of Crystal Grains

Here we developed a new method to quantitatively characterize the spatial distribution of the Bronsted acidity of HZSM-5 zeolite on the crystal grains level indirectly. The Bronsted acid sites of HZSM-5 zeolite completely covered or blocked by previous coke deposition were released gradually from the outer surface to the center of the crystal grains via shrinking core mode isothermal oxidation with high temperature and low oxygen concentration. The spatial distribution of the coke was obtained based on the one-dimensional position coordinate L-rp through building and solving an enhanced shrinking core model. Then the released acidity characterized by n-propylamine temperature-programmed decomposition was correlated to the specific position of L-rp. The results show that the acid density is roughly homogenous while the acid strength is heterogeneous within the crystal grains. From the outer surface to the center of the crystal grains, the strength of the Bronsted acid sites increase gradually.
